Skip to content

Update emitter naming terminology: cadl-ranch → spector, Modular → JS Emitter#3957

Open
JialinHuang803 wants to merge 2 commits into
Azure:mainfrom
JialinHuang803:fix/update-emitter-naming-terminology
Open

Update emitter naming terminology: cadl-ranch → spector, Modular → JS Emitter#3957
JialinHuang803 wants to merge 2 commits into
Azure:mainfrom
JialinHuang803:fix/update-emitter-naming-terminology

Conversation

@JialinHuang803
Copy link
Copy Markdown
Member

Addresses #3792

Changes

cadl-ranch → spector

  • Renamed \gen-cadl-ranch.js\ → \gen-spector.js\ and \cadl-ranch-list.js\ → \spector-list.js\
  • Updated all references in package.json scripts, launch.json, nightly.yml, CONTRIBUTING.md, copilot-instructions.md, and SKILL.md

Modular → JS Emitter (documentation only)

  • Updated test labels and section headings: Modular → JS Emitter throughout copilot-instructions.md
  • Updated README.md option descriptions to use 'TypeSpec-generated SDK' instead of 'Modular'

HLC → AutoRest (documentation only)

  • Renamed CI job \HLC_Generation\ → \AutoRest_Generation\ in ci.yml
  • Updated HLC references to AutoRest in test scenario docs

No code logic or directory structure changes — documentation and naming only.

JialinHuang803 and others added 2 commits May 12, 2026 16:02
- Rename gen-cadl-ranch.js to gen-spector.js
- Rename cadl-ranch-list.js to spector-list.js
- Update all references in package.json scripts, launch.json, CI pipelines,
  CONTRIBUTING.md, copilot-instructions.md, and SKILL.md
- Update spector-list.js with latest entries from upstream
- Replace HLC terminology with AutoRest in CI and test docs
- Update README.md option descriptions to remove Modular jargon

Fixes Azure#3792

Co-authored-by: Copilot <223556219+Copilot@users.noreply.github.com>
@JialinHuang803 JialinHuang803 linked an issue May 12, 2026 that may be closed by this pull request
@qiaozha qiaozha added P1 priority 1 HRLC labels May 13, 2026
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Labels

HRLC P1 priority 1

Projects

None yet

Development

Successfully merging this pull request may close these issues.

Update emitter code and documentation naming

2 participants